Zerrissenheit
inner turmoil, torn feeling, emotional fragmentation
noun tsair-RIS-en-hite Rare
Usage Note
Zerrissenheit describes a feeling of being torn apart internally by conflicting loyalties, desires, or emotions. It is a strong, literary word — innere Zerrissenheit (inner turmoil) is very common in literary criticism and self-reflection.
Examples
"Die innere Zerrissenheit zwischen Pflicht und Leidenschaft ließ ihn nachts nicht schlafen."
Natural Translation
The inner turmoil between duty and passion kept him awake at night.
Literal Translation
The inner torn-apart-ness between duty and passion let him nights not sleep.
